IPL 2018: Chennai Super Kings trump SRH in thriller, enter final
Updated On May 22, 2018 11:41 PM IST
Two-time champions Chennai Super Kings marched into the final of the Indian Premier League (IPL) after Faf du Plessis smashed a blistering 67 not out to fashion their thrilling two-wicket victory against Sunrisers Hyderabad on Wednesday.
